USER NEEDS

Pain Points:

  • Frustration with AI tools fixing one issue but creating multiple new bugs
  • Lack of coding experience leading to debugging difficulties
  • Time-consuming debugging processes (days spent on minor changes)
  • AI tools losing context in larger projects
  • Feeling overwhelmed and demotivated by constant errors

Problems to Solve:

  • Building a functional application without coding knowledge
  • Efficient debugging of AI-generated code
  • Maintaining motivation through development challenges
  • Understanding complex code structures without technical background

Potential Solutions:

  • Learning basic coding fundamentals to better understand and debug
  • Using modular development approaches (breaking projects into smaller components)
  • Partnering with technical co-founders or hiring developers
  • Switching to no-code platforms like Bubble
  • Using AI as a teaching tool rather than full code generator
  • Implementing version control (e.g., Git) for easier rollbacks
